Enhanced antioxidant activities of metal conjugates of curcumin derivatives.

S Dutta1, A Murugkar, N Gandhe, S Padhye.   

Abstract

Antioxidant properties of three Curcumin derivatives in which the 1,3-diketone system is appended with nitrogen and sulfur donors and their copper conjugates are examined for the first time. Metal conjugation seems to offer distinct advantages in radical scavenging activities of curcumin compounds.
